201 fromText =
new javax.swing.JLabel();
202 toLabel =
new javax.swing.JLabel();
203 toText =
new javax.swing.JLabel();
204 ccLabel =
new javax.swing.JLabel();
205 ccText =
new javax.swing.JLabel();
212 htmlPane =
new javax.swing.JPanel();
221 envelopePanel.setBackground(
new java.awt.Color(204, 204, 204));
223 org.openide.awt.Mnemonics.setLocalizedText(
fromLabel,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.fromLabel.text"));
225 datetimeText.setHorizontalAlignment(javax.swing.SwingConstants.RIGHT);
226 org.openide.awt.Mnemonics.setLocalizedText(
datetimeText,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.datetimeText.text"));
228 org.openide.awt.Mnemonics.setLocalizedText(
fromText,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.fromText.text"));
230 org.openide.awt.Mnemonics.setLocalizedText(
toLabel,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.toLabel.text"));
232 org.openide.awt.Mnemonics.setLocalizedText(
toText,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.toText.text"));
233 toText.setAutoscrolls(
true);
234 toText.setMinimumSize(
new java.awt.Dimension(27, 14));
236 org.openide.awt.Mnemonics.setLocalizedText(
ccLabel,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.ccLabel.text"));
238 org.openide.awt.Mnemonics.setLocalizedText(
ccText,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.ccText.text"));
239 ccText.setMinimumSize(
new java.awt.Dimension(27, 14));
241 org.openide.awt.Mnemonics.setLocalizedText(
subjectLabel,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.subjectLabel.text"));
243 org.openide.awt.Mnemonics.setLocalizedText(
subjectText,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.subjectText.text"));
244 subjectText.setMinimumSize(
new java.awt.Dimension(26, 14));
246 directionText.setHorizontalAlignment(javax.swing.SwingConstants.RIGHT);
247 org.openide.awt.Mnemonics.setLocalizedText(
directionText, org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.directionText.text"));
249 javax.swing.GroupLayout envelopePanelLayout =
new javax.swing.GroupLayout(
envelopePanel);
251 envelopePanelLayout.setHorizontalGroup(
252 env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
253 .addGroup(envelopePanelLayout.createSequentialGroup()
255 .addGroup(env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
256 .addGroup(envelopePanelLayout.createSequentialGroup()
257 .addGroup(env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
260 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.UNRELATED)
261 .addGroup(env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
262 .addGroup(envelopePanelLayout.createSequentialGroup()
263 .addComponent(
toText,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)
264 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.UNRELATED)
265 .addComponent(
directionText, javax.swing.GroupLayout.PREFERRED_SIZE, 66, javax.swing.GroupLayout.PREFERRED_SIZE))
266 .addGroup(envelopePanelLayout.createSequentialGroup()
267 .addComponent(
fromText,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)
268 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.UNRELATED)
269 .addComponent(
datetimeText, javax.swing.GroupLayout.PREFERRED_SIZE, 140, javax.swing.GroupLayout.PREFERRED_SIZE))))
270 .addGroup(envelopePanelLayout.createSequentialGroup()
273 .addComponent(
ccText,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E))
274 .addGroup(envelopePanelLayout.createSequentialGroup()
276 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
277 .addComponent(
subjectText,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)))
280 envelopePanelLayout.setVerticalGroup(
281 env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
282 .addGroup(envelopePanelLayout.createSequentialGroup()
284 .addGroup(env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.BASELINE)
288 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
289 .addGroup(env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.BASELINE)
291 .addComponent(
toText,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
293 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
294 .addGroup(env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.BASELINE)
296 .addComponent(
ccText,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E))
297 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
298 .addGroup(envelopePan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.BASELINE)
300 .addComponent(
subjectText,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E))
304 headersScrollPane.setHorizontalScrollBarPolicy(javax.swing.ScrollPaneConstants.HORIZONTAL_SCROLLBAR_NEVER);
305 headersScrollPane.setVerticalScrollBarPolicy(javax.swing.ScrollPaneConstants.VERTICAL_SCROLLBAR_ALWAYS);
316 htmlPane.setLayout(
new java.awt.BorderLayout());
319 rtfbodyScrollPane.setVerticalScrollBarPolicy(javax.swing.ScrollPaneConstants.VERTICAL_SCROLLBAR_ALWAYS);
328 public void actionPerformed(java.awt.event.ActionEvent evt) {
329 viewInNewWindowButtonActionPerformed(evt);
333 javax.swing.GroupLayout attachmentsPanelLayout =
new javax.swing.GroupLayout(attachmentsPanel);
334 attachmentsPanel.setLayout(attachmentsPanelLayout);
335 attachmentsPanelLayout.setHorizontalGroup(
336 attachmentsPan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
337 .addGroup(attachmentsPanelLayout.createSequentialGroup()
339 .addGroup(attachmentsPan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
340 .addGroup(javax.swing.GroupLayout.Alignment.TRAILING, attachmentsPanelLayout.createSequentialGroup()
341 .addComponent(viewInNewWindowButton)
343 .addComponent(attachmentsScrollPane, javax.swing.GroupLayout.Alignment.TRAILING, javax.swing.GroupLayout.DEFAULT_SIZE, 647, Short.MAX_VALUE)))
345 attachmentsPanelLayout.setVerticalGroup(
346 attachmentsPanelLayout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
347 .addGroup(attachmentsPanelLayout.createSequentialGroup()
349 .addComponent(viewInNewWindowButton)
350 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
351 .addComponent(attachmentsScrollPane, javax.swing.GroupLayout.DEFAULT_SIZE, 333, Short.MAX_VALUE)
355 msgbodyTabbedPane.addTab(org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.attachmentsPanel.TabConstraints.tabTitle"), attachmentsPanel);
357 accountsTab.setLayout(
new java.awt.BorderLayout());
358 accountsTab.add(accountScrollPane, java.awt.BorderLayout.CENTER);
360 msgbodyTabbedPane.addTab(org.openide.util.NbBundle.getMessage(
MessageArtifactViewer.class,
"MessageArtifactViewer.accountsTab.TabConstraints.tabTitle"), accountsTab);
362 javax.swing.GroupLayout
layout =
new javax.swing.GroupLayout(
this);
364 layout.setHorizontalGroup(
365 lay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
366 .addGroup(
layout.createSequentialGroup()
368 .addGroup(
lay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
369 .addComponent(msgbodyTabbedPane)
370 .addComponent(envelopePanel,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E))
374 lay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
375 .addGroup(
layout.createSequentialGroup()
377 .addComponent(envelopePanel,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
378 .add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
379 .addComponent(msgbodyTabbedPane)